Product Description
It all began on a lavender blue daythe kind of day when anything can happen. It was on such a day that Anna Lavinias father saw a double rainbow and went chasing after it. And it is on such a day that she and her cat, Strawberry, set off on their journey beyond the walled garden where the pawpaw trees grow, to a place where the buttercups bloom pink and the laws of gravity dont always apply. Here Anna Lavinia will test her mothers advice Never believe what you see, against her fathers wise words Believe only what you see, and just maybe shell finally be able to use the mysterious silver key her father left behind when he went chasing after rainbows.

is a tour through a land as strange and wonderful as Oz, filled with people as delightfully batty as any in Alices looking glass. It is a place to return to again and again, beautifully brought to life in Palmer Browns fanciful words and intricate, sugar-spun drawings.
